Suicide is the leading cause of death for Australian 18-24 year olds. Dr Sandra Garrido leads Moody Tunes - an app harnessing the power of music to increase mental health literacy and decrease stress and anxiety @AusMusPsySoc#AMPS2024

#BambooFamilies DAY 5: REFLECT
Parental reflective functioning is trying to understand children’s/your own thoughts, feelings, intentions.
Dr Vincent Mancini, @telethonkids, chats about this and its positive impacts on relationships: https://t.co/rInmUUk96w
#BambooFamilies Day 3:
Relational savouring is used to prolong the positive emotions you experience when spending time with loved ones.
Listen to Dr Jessie Borelli talk about this technique: https://t.co/uqwvIdvMA9
